How A Warner Robins Septic System Works
From Toilet To Tank To Drainfield
After flushing a toilet the solids and liquids travel down a plumbing line into the septic tank. The septic tank is a vault, which traps solid waste and allows clear liquid to flow through to the drainfield. Inside the septic tank solids and liquids separate into 3 layers. The top layer is called the residue layer it includes floatables consisting of: fats, oils, grease, soaps, and phosphates. The middle layer is the liquid layer and the bottom layer is the sludge layer. The sludge layer includes heavy particles of organic matter which breakdown through an anaerobic process. The clear water exits the tank through an outlet baffle and is dispersed into the drainfield which absorbs the water.
